This is a shuffle game that launches balls creating an unusual dimensionalvisual effect through the use ofa mirror. This version has the yellowball launcher instead of the drab blue one. The yellow really pops where the typical blue background is dull and the balls are hard to see. This version also is the size of a pinball machine so it can fit anywhere easily. The object of the game is to line up three, four, or five ballsin a row vertically, horizontally, or corner diagonally to achieve the most points. Once you have a match, you press the button on top to cash in your points. If you have three in a row, you do not have to cash in. You can try to make it four or five in a row. I usually will cash in. After you get your points, the balls launch again. You have ten shots. If the balls on start up land in a pattern you can use, you can cash in. The balls will launch again and you will still be on the first shot. One time I had five in a row before I took my first shot. This is a challenging one player game. It is set on free play.
